STUDENTS at Halesowen College have been helping to organise the Emerge Festival, putting on drama, music and dance performances inspired by the works of William Shakespeare.

A group of 12 students are signed up for the project, which will see them expand their skills and achieve a ‘Gold Arts Award’ qualification thanks to their help in planning and marketing the event.

The college is working alongside Earls High School and the Manic Arts Theatre Company on the special project which started towards the end of last year.

The family friendly festival will take place at Haden Hill House and Park, in Cradley Heath, on Saturday, April 21, with the free event open to the public.

Jessica Dalton-Leggett, project organiser from the college, said: “This is a fantastic partnership project to be part of and the students are enjoying every minute.

“They are giving up their free time to be creative and devise performances based on the work of William Shakespeare.”
